Reviving this thread to see if anyone could help me with my question.. would it be possible to upgrade from PE to Business with JAL Mileage Bank points on AA marketed JL operated flights?
byroshi is offline  
Old Oct 14, 2019, 4:51 pm
  #18  
FlyerTalk Evangelist
 
Join Date: Jul 2011
Location: Tokyo
Programs: JAL Metal Card (OWE), SAS Eurobonus Gold (*G), Marriott Titanium (LTP), Tokyu Hotels Platinum
Posts: 21,170
Originally Posted by byroshi
Reviving this thread to see if anyone could help me with my question.. would it be possible to upgrade from PE to Business with JAL Mileage Bank points on AA marketed JL operated flights?
No. Needs to be JAL marketed.

Originally Posted by TTmex
Am I right in my understanding that JAL rarely (or never) offers at desk upgrades to Business? I've got a return DFW-NRT/HND... DFW-NRT on the way out on AA (bought through JAL) and return on JAL from HND-DFW. I flew AA from Miami to Milan and remember they were offering 550 USD to upgrade from PE to Business, so understand this may be offered when flying the AA leg (albeit probably at a higher rate if at all). Right in thinking JAL is a no-no? Not the end of the world, just want to manage expectations. I'm in PE
JAL does not offer cash upgrades from Y or PY to J. You can upgrade with JMB miles.
